#2c348f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2c348f is composed of 17.3% red, 20.4%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.2% cyan, 63.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.9% black. It has a hue angle of 235.2 degrees, a saturation of 52.9% and a lightness of 36.7%. #2c348f color hex could be obtained by blending #5868ff with #00001f.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

Shades and Tints of #2c348f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020308 is the darkest color, while #f8f8f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#2c348f
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#575864 is the less saturated color, while #0110ba is the most saturated one.
